介绍
Clash是一款功能强大的网络代理工具,它支持多种协议,并且具备灵活的配置选项,帮助用户在各种网络环境下实现匿名上网、加速和绕过地域限制等功能。本文将深入探讨Clash中的Proxy配置,帮助用户掌握如何高效地使用和配置Clash的Proxy功能。
什么是Clash的Proxy
Proxy(代理)是指通过中介服务器转发用户请求的技术,它在Clash中起到了至关重要的作用。Clash通过配置不同类型的Proxy,帮助用户解决网络问题,实现流量转发、负载均衡、加速访问等功能。
Clash支持的Proxy类型
Clash支持多种代理协议,每种协议都有其独特的功能和用途。常见的Proxy类型包括:
- HTTP Proxy:通过HTTP协议转发流量,常用于浏览器代理。
- SOCKS5 Proxy:比HTTP更强大的代理协议,支持多种应用程序。
- Shadowsocks Proxy:一种常用于翻墙的协议,支持加密流量。
- Vmess Proxy:V2Ray协议的一部分,支持强大的安全性和隐私保护功能。
- Trojan Proxy:一种兼容HTTPS的代理协议,主要用于隐匿流量,避免被检测。
Clash的Proxy功能
Clash的Proxy功能不仅支持多种协议,还允许用户灵活配置路由规则、自动选择最优代理节点等。
- 路由规则:用户可以根据不同的需求设置路由规则,实现特定流量通过指定的Proxy。
- 节点负载均衡:Clash支持多个代理节点的负载均衡,自动选择最快的节点。
- 策略组:Clash的策略组功能可以让用户根据不同的需求选择代理策略,灵活切换代理方式。
如何配置Clash的Proxy
配置Clash的Proxy相对简单,但为了确保正确的功能,用户需要根据实际需求设置相应的代理协议和路由规则。
安装Clash
在配置Proxy之前,首先需要安装Clash。Clash支持多平台,包括Windows、macOS和Linux。
- 访问Clash的官方网站,下载适合您系统的版本。
- 根据提示完成安装,确保安装路径没有错误。
- 启动Clash应用程序,进入主界面。
配置Proxy节点
安装完Clash后,下一步是配置Proxy节点。在Clash中,Proxy节点通常是由外部服务提供的,用户需要将这些节点信息导入Clash。
- 打开Clash的配置文件,通常是
config.yaml
。 - 在
proxies
部分添加节点信息。
yaml proxies:
- name: “Proxy1” type: ss server: 1.1.1.1 port: 1080 cipher: aes-128-gcm password: “password” – name: “Proxy2” type: vmess server: 2.2.2.2 port: 443 uuid: “x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x” alterId: 64
- 保存并关闭配置文件。
配置路由规则
配置完Proxy节点后,用户可以设置路由规则来决定哪些流量走哪些Proxy。
- 打开配置文件,找到
rules
部分。 - 添加或修改路由规则。
yaml rules:
- DOMAIN-SUFFIX,google.com,Proxy1
- DOMAIN-SUFFIX,youtube.com,Proxy2
- 保存并关闭配置文件,重新启动Clash。
配置策略组
策略组可以让用户灵活选择代理方式。通过策略组,用户可以选择不同的代理策略,例如使用最快的节点,或者选择特定地区的节点。
- 打开配置文件,找到
proxy-groups
部分。 - 添加策略组。
yaml proxy-groups:
- name: “Auto” type: select proxies:
- Proxy1
- Proxy2
- 保存并关闭配置文件。
常见问题解答
Clash的Proxy有什么作用?
Clash的Proxy主要用于网络代理,帮助用户绕过地域限制、加速访问特定网站、保护隐私等。通过配置Proxy,用户可以实现更加安全和灵活的网络连接。
如何选择Clash的Proxy协议?
选择Proxy协议时,用户应根据实际需求进行选择。如果主要是浏览网页,可以选择HTTP Proxy。如果需要更强的隐私保护,可以选择Shadowsocks或V2Ray等协议。
Clash的Proxy节点如何添加?
添加Proxy节点的步骤如下:
- 打开Clash的配置文件
config.yaml
。 - 在
proxies
部分添加节点信息。 - 保存并重新启动Clash。
Clash的Proxy配置如何优化?
为了优化Clash的Proxy配置,可以考虑以下几点:
- 使用多个节点,确保流量转发的高可用性。
- 配置路由规则,确保特定流量走特定Proxy。
- 配置负载均衡,确保选择最优的Proxy节点。
Clash的Proxy与VPN有何区别?
Clash的Proxy与VPN的主要区别在于,Proxy主要转发特定流量,而VPN会加密并转发所有流量。Proxy灵活性更高,但VPN通常提供更高的隐私保护。
结论
Clash的Proxy功能为用户提供了多样化的选择和灵活的配置选项,使得用户能够根据需求优化自己的网络环境。通过合理配置Proxy,用户可以提高网络访问速度,绕过地域限制,保护隐私,甚至在复杂的网络环境中保证网络安全。掌握Clash的Proxy配置技巧,能够让你更好地利用这一强大工具。